U.S. Air Force Col. Kevin Robbins, 1st Fighter Wing commander, talks with Distinguished Service Cross recipient James K. Kunkle on the flight line of Langley Air Force Base, Va., prior to the start of an F-22 Raptor demo, during a Legion of Valor tour, May 31, 2012. Kunkle, a combat pilot with the 1st FW during World War II, flew P-38 and P-57 aircraft. Kunkle received his medal for engaging 20 German aircraft, and downing two of them. (U.S. Air Force photo by Senior Airman Wesley Farnsworth/Released)
